The final price for your hardscape project depends on a few key factors. First, the size of the area and the specific materials you choose—like natural stone versus standard concrete—will change the bottom line. Site conditions also matter; if your yard requires significant grading, drainage work, or removal of old structures, costs will rise. While concrete may have a lower upfront cost, pavers often provide better long-term value for Oceanside properties. Pavers are more resistant to cracking from temperature fluctuations and can be individually repaired, unlike a concrete slab. This makes them a more sustainable and often more cost-effective choice over time.

Yes, a sand setting bed is essential for a stable paver installation. It creates a smooth, level surface for the pavers to rest on and allows for minor adjustments. This is crucial in Oceanside to ensure your patio remains stable and doesn't shift or settle unevenly, especially with our coastal climate and soil conditions.

Hardscaping refers to the non-living, structural elements of your landscape, such as patios, walkways, driveways, and retaining walls. It's about creating functional and aesthetically pleasing outdoor features. For an Oceanside home, this could mean a beautiful paver patio for enjoying the ocean breeze or a durable pathway.
A classic example of hardscaping is a custom paver patio that provides a perfect space for outdoor entertaining or a stylish walkway made of natural stone leading to your front door. Other examples include outdoor kitchens, fire pits, and decorative walls. These elements add structure, purpose, and beauty to your outdoor living area.
